How valuable is just asking people?

Last updated: December 11, 2024 6:56 am
Share
How valuable is just asking people?
SHARE

A Fresh Perspective on Assessing the Economy

In the world of economic analysis, there is often a tug-of-war between those who rely on statistics and graphs to assess the state of the economy and those who prefer to gauge economic conditions by talking to people on the ground. This dichotomy can lead to heated debates and conflicting viewpoints, as illustrated in the following three-act story:

Act One: The Activist’s Concern

It all begins with an activist or TV personality sounding the alarm about the failing economy, especially for those who are already struggling. Their message is clear: economic conditions are dire for many individuals and families.

Act Two: The Economist’s Rebuttal

Enter the economist, armed with a barrage of statistics and graphs to counter the activist’s claims. They argue that the economy is actually doing quite well, pointing to a range of data to support their assertion.

Act Three: The Clash of Perspectives

The activist dismisses the economist’s arguments, emphasizing the importance of listening to the voices of ordinary people who are grappling with financial hardships. They highlight the disconnect between abstract economic indicators and the lived experiences of individuals.

While both viewpoints have merit, it is essential to acknowledge the limitations of relying solely on either approach. Economic data can provide valuable insights into overall trends, but it may not capture the full extent of people’s economic well-being. Conversely, anecdotal accounts from individuals may be influenced by personal biases and political affiliations, leading to subjective interpretations of economic realities.

For instance, consider the fluctuating public opinion on the economy based on political affiliations. A graph depicting Republican and Democratic sentiments during different presidencies reveals a stark contrast in perceptions, influenced by partisan loyalties rather than objective economic conditions.

Ultimately, assessing the strength of the economy requires a nuanced understanding that combines quantitative analysis with qualitative insights. By recognizing the complex interplay between data-driven assessments and real-world experiences, we can gain a more comprehensive understanding of economic dynamics.
